Fjerde lørdag i november er mindedag for ofrene for Holodomor. Millioner af ukrainere døde i årene 1932-33 som følge af Stalin-styrets menneskeskabte hungersnød. Læs evt. mere på hjemmesiden for Holodomor-museet i Kyiv: https://t.co/P4TYrcxQQx

This morning began with one of the largest Russian strikes on Ukraine. 210 missiles and drones, including aeroballistic and hypersonic missiles, as well as dozens of Shahed drones, were launched. All of them targeted civilian infrastructure—critical facilities like power plants and transformers.
Putin drowns the world in his rhetoric, but his only true message is written in destruction and death, delivered through every missile and drone Russia sends.

Over the past week, the aggressor used nearly 140 missiles of various types, more than 900 guided aerial bombs, and over 600 strike drones. Today, our F-16 pilots shot down approximately 10 aerial targets. Efforts to address the consequences of the combined attack on our infrastructure in the Rivne, Lviv, Dnipropetrovsk, Volyn, and Odesa regions are ongoing.
